Output eba62155da4e624241585673e0c2290246ad192869a2bc361f8a1b3d4b5696ba:0

value
8901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2336178234ce441686d11713c3709684d87b128 OP_EQUAL
address
3LrTNpmswzu1Hm7oLqKsLpkTrGwrohw1Yk
transaction
eba62155da4e624241585673e0c2290246ad192869a2bc361f8a1b3d4b5696ba
confirmations
33881
spent
true